- The distance between Edirne, Turkey and Ras Elnakb, Egypt is approximately 1,533 km or 952 mi.
- To reach Edirne in this distance one would set out from Ras Elnakb bearing 333.4°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Edirne bearing 328.6° or NNW .
- Edirne has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Ras Elnakb has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Edirne is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Ras Elnakb is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.4 °C (11.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.6 °C (8.3°F) more in Edirne.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 557.6 mm (22 in) more which is equivalent to 557.6 l/m² (13.68 US gal/ft²) or 5,576,000 l/ha (596,111 US gal/ac) more. About 28 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.1° lower in Edirne than in Ras Elnakb.
